Pinson, AL
How exposed is Pinson to wildfire?
USFS scores Pinson at the 73rd national percentile for wildfire risk to structures (well above the national norm for wildfire risk), a figure built from 3,675 real buildings rather than raw vegetation cover. (Source: USFS's Wildfire Risk to Communities methodology.)
USFS's separate burn-probability score — fire likelihood alone, before counting what's built there — puts Pinson at the 76th percentile, close to its 73rd-percentile risk score.
Where Pinson's buildings actually sit
USFS classifies 73.3% of Pinson's buildings as Direct exposure, higher than its 24.5% Indirect share and far above its 2.2% Minimal share — a profile where 2,694 structures sit close enough to vegetation that lot clearing matters most.
How Pinson compares
Inside Alabama, Pinson sits at just the 54th percentile even though it scores 73rd nationally — the state's overall wildfire exposure is high enough to make this a relatively quiet corner of it. Among the 31,521 US communities USFS scores, Pinson ranks 8,530 for wildfire risk (1 is highest) and 4,556 by building count (1 is largest). Within Alabama alone, it ranks 276 of 592 places by risk.
